안녕하세요
4번 문항 정답을 봐도 이해가 안되서 문의 드립니다.
index 에서 범위, 행, 열에서 열값 역시 match 함수로 되는게 아닌가 했는데 정답과 달라서 풀이 해설 좀 부탁 드립니다.
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
로 입력한 후 채우기 핸들을 사용하시면
오른쪽으로 채우기 핸들을 사용했을 때
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*F$4:F$33,1),($A$4:$A$33=$O9)*F$4:F$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*G$4:G$33,1),($A$4:$A$33=$O9)*G$4:G$33,0))
...
빨간색으로 표시된 부분이 변경되면서
인문대학별 건강보험연계, 해외취업자, 창업자, 프리랜서에 해당하는 부분을 찾을 수 있습니다.
채우기 핸들을 아래쪽으로 내리면
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*E$4:E$33,1),($A$4:$A$33=$O10)*E$4:E$33,0))
사회과학대학으로 변경 되고
오른쪽으로 채우기 핸들을 사용하시면
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*E$4:E$33,1),($A$4:$A$33=$O10)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*F$4:F$33,1),($A$4:$A$33=$O10)*F$4:F$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*G$4:G$33,1),($A$4:$A$33=$O10)*G$4:G$33,0))
...
로 사회과학대학별 건강보험연계, 해외취업자, 창업자, 프리랜서에 해당하는 부분을 찾을 수 있습니다.
이렇게 절대참조와 혼합참조를 잘 사용하시면 하나의 식으로 여러 값을 정확하게 나타낼 수 있습니다.
-
관리자2021-02-17 19:41:19
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
로 입력한 후 채우기 핸들을 사용하시면
오른쪽으로 채우기 핸들을 사용했을 때
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*F$4:F$33,1),($A$4:$A$33=$O9)*F$4:F$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*G$4:G$33,1),($A$4:$A$33=$O9)*G$4:G$33,0))
...
빨간색으로 표시된 부분이 변경되면서
인문대학별 건강보험연계, 해외취업자, 창업자, 프리랜서에 해당하는 부분을 찾을 수 있습니다.
채우기 핸들을 아래쪽으로 내리면
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*E$4:E$33,1),($A$4:$A$33=$O10)*E$4:E$33,0))
사회과학대학으로 변경 되고
오른쪽으로 채우기 핸들을 사용하시면
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*E$4:E$33,1),($A$4:$A$33=$O10)*E$4:E$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*F$4:F$33,1),($A$4:$A$33=$O10)*F$4:F$33,0))
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O10)*G$4:G$33,1),($A$4:$A$33=$O10)*G$4:G$33,0))
...
로 사회과학대학별 건강보험연계, 해외취업자, 창업자, 프리랜서에 해당하는 부분을 찾을 수 있습니다.
이렇게 절대참조와 혼합참조를 잘 사용하시면 하나의 식으로 여러 값을 정확하게 나타낼 수 있습니다.
-
관리자2021-02-18 19:02:40
=INDEX($B$4:$B$33,M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0))
빨간색은 범위, 보라색은 행 입니다.
열은 생략 되었으므로 1로 지정됩니다.
행에 사용된 MATCH(LARGE(($A$4:$A$33=$O9)*E$4:E$33,1),($A$4:$A$33=$O9)*E$4:E$33,0) 0은
match 의 옵션 입니다.
-1 : 찾을 값 보다 크거나 같은 값 중 가장 작은 값을 찾습니다. 범위는 반드시 내림차순으로 정렬되어 있어야 합니다.
0 : 찾을 값에서 첫번째로 정확하게 일치하는 값을 찾습니다. 범위는 정렬 되어 있지 않아도 됩니다.
1 : 찾을 값 보다 작거나 같은 값 중에서 큰 값을 찾습니다. 범위는 반드시 오름차순으로 정렬 되어 있어야 합니다.
생략할시 1로 지정되므로 오름차순 정렬된 상태라면 옵션을 생략하거나 1을 입력하셔도 정확한 결과가 나오는 것입니다.범위의 값이 정렬된 것을 확인 하셔야 합니다.
내림차순이면 -1, 오름차순이면 1, 정확하게 일치하는 값은 0 이 됩니다.
이문제에서는 해당 범위가 정렬된 상태가 아니기 때문에 정확히 일치하는 값을 찾는 0 을 사용해야 하는 것입니다.
좋은 하루 되세요.
-
*2021-02-17 22:05:43
네 확인했습니다. INDEX 함수에서 범위, 행, 열로 알고 있는데 그럼 large는 최대 취업자인 큰 값을 찾는것으로 ,1은 이해했는데 열찾기에서 ,0이 잘 이해가 안됩니다.ㅜ